* Fold default properties checksum calculation into getChecksum() so changes in

default properties will get picked up even if they were already consumed by other
  child properties.
* Reimplement update algorithm using a temporary ResourceProperties object to
  avoid getting into unconsistent state by invoking clear().
* Use uppercase name for final CACHE_TIME field.
* Make update() synchronized as concurrent invocation could be absolutely harmful.
